U.S. Senator Tom Harkin, chairman of the Senate education committee, will hold a fifth hearing on for-profit colleges on June 7.

The hearing will focus on debt levels among former students of the colleges, said Justine Sessions, a spokeswoman for Harkin, an Iowa Democrat. A list of witnesses for the hearing is forthcoming, she said today in a telephone interview.
